Output eb5f90aa67fb4715535513b9bf4bb7faab8484b7e2b384c7ea2ebe1250c4e01d:0

value
4503003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e84b34939df99d498e3a507fc9c566f3b8897c94 OP_EQUAL
address
3NsGnQiJ4DoKyZbHmVEufPTwa981LcAXHA
transaction
eb5f90aa67fb4715535513b9bf4bb7faab8484b7e2b384c7ea2ebe1250c4e01d
confirmations
332323
spent
true